Photo, Print, DrawingLa destruction de la statue royale a Nouvelle Yorck Die zerstorung der koniglichen bild saule zu Neu Yorck. 1 print : etching, hand-colored ; plate 28 x 40.8 cm, sheet 32.2 x 48.8 cm | Print shows a misguided attempt by the artist to depict the destruction of an equestrian statue of King George III in New York City on July 9, 1776; this view shows what appear to be mostly slaves attempting to pull over the statue of a man standing,…
- Contributor: Basset, André, Active - Basset, André
- Date: 1770

Photo, Print, DrawingThe tea-tax-tempest, or the Anglo-American revolution 1 print : engraving. | A satire expressing a Continental European view of the American Revolution, showing Father Time using a magic lantern to project the image of a teapot exploding among frightened British troops as American troops advance through the smoke. In the midst of the smoke is a "Gallic cock" seated on a bellows fanning the flames beneath the teapot. Figures representing…
